Transaction 513db500e5ea2e3641f0dd792968f4884115bcdc8e9c4306322940d57e10245e

1 Input
2 Outputs
  • 513db500e5ea2e3641f0dd792968f4884115bcdc8e9c4306322940d57e10245e:0
  • value  2500000
    address  17oTeHuXJb6jaDEiVgHbQbA61AwRfcLLv7
  • 513db500e5ea2e3641f0dd792968f4884115bcdc8e9c4306322940d57e10245e:1
  • value  2532007
    address  37ZXp4F3rpUDc4GGEE8RQTJmoyhotDtNBS